I have to agree that really an indoor bun needs to wait until the temperature outside warms up, unless you have a heated shed/garage where he is to live. Night time temperatures can still plummet even at Easter, and house buns won't have been able to grow a proper outdoor coat if they have been indoors living in a heated house.
